Here we go, Alpha 32.7-0 is now available!

    Release notes - Airport CEO - Version Alpha 32.7-0

Improvement

  • [ACEO-14939] - Added conveyor belt escalator direction guide icons
  • [ACEO-14942] - Added temperature modifier value based on airport location to avoid de-icing and cold weather coniditions in countries with traditionally warm climate

Bug

  • [ACEO-14508] - Improved tutorial step completion background color to better accommodate reading experience
  • [ACEO-14543] - Switching floor causes vehicle animations to reset
  • [ACEO-14559] - Trucks resupplying a certain depot can become stuck in a delivery loop as they do not correctly account for shipment relevancy
  • [ACEO-14577] - Pushback truck tow bar visible on lower ground floors
  • [ACEO-14868] - Fuel trucks perform a pirouette before exiting fuel depot
  • [ACEO-14872] - De-icing fluid depot panel incorrectly displays percentage symbol instead of fluid amount symbol
  • [ACEO-14898] - Assigned fuel truck at closed stand can in certain instances get stuck in a loop
  • [ACEO-14928] - Waste reduction calculation method for waste depots can cause garbage trucks to get stuck
  • [ACEO-14938] - Airport fees resets when loading a saved airport

No, the temperature simulation was improved as of Alpha 32 (when launch)ed which in turn have made the rest of the weather simulation better as a lot of the precipitation amounts are determined with temperature as a key input value. ACEO-14942 basically makes sure that it will not get cold or snow in traditionally warm countries, which consequently means aircraft will not invoke a de-icing requests in those areas.

If it works that is, needs to be tested in mass with various airports around the world, which is why it’s on experimental now! :wink:
